Transaction d63dd232e7dd331a6abe4ede9f2854fc5fcd4bf5c71266a9b4d6910ff49a953b
1 Input
1 Outputs
- d63dd232e7dd331a6abe4ede9f2854fc5fcd4bf5c71266a9b4d6910ff49a953b:0
value 3025751
address 33jt9hNBmsdBExynREBnjn1Qbk5xPGWJwx